[Photograph 2012.201.B0931.0341]

Photograph used for a story in the Daily Oklahoman newspaper. Caption: "It's Not Often you see a hammer throw event in a track meet. In fast, the contestants don't actually throw hammers. But that's what it's ca;;ed and Oklahoma has one of the nation's best in former Oklahoma Christian star Jim Neugent, Jim won the event in last Saturday's OCC Relays, reaching a distance of 186 feet two inches. That broke his own meet record by almost 27 feet."

[Photograph 2012.201.OVZ001.1275]

Photograph used for a story in the Oklahoma City Times newspaper. Caption: "Fire, fueled by an accumulation of old paint and fanned by north winds gusting to 40 miles an hour, destroyed the A&A Guaranteed Auto Painting Co. shop this morning at 407 NW 8. Capt. Eldon Tinsley, acting district fire chief, estimated danage at $75,000. About 15 automobiles in the shop for paint and body repairs were damaged. The blaze, shooting through roof skylights when firemen arrived shortly after 2:20 a.m., was confined to the shop building. About 20 residents of upstairs apartments in a building to the east were evacuated, but firemen kept the blaze from spreading. The roof and a portion of one wall collapsed but none of the firemen from 12 units answering the two alarms were injured."
